Description of the problem | I was not told by either toyota or toyota of tampa bay that there was an oil leak problem. I never received a notice in the mail. When i took my car in for service because of a burning smell, i was told to bring it back after driving for a 1,000 miles. I didn't - my error, but i wasn't told there was a warrenty or any kind of major issue. When i did go back, they ran the test again, telling me i'd get a new engine if there was a problem. When i did come back, the story changed to a rebuild engine. Then, when the service rep came to tell me the issue, he said my car had the issue, but the warranty had expired. My car, a 2009, has 67,000 miles on it. |
